8 часов назад
Но как указать при Авторизации, сделать так, что бы проверяло логины только собственников, и если там вводят логин Риелтора, выдало ошибку, и писало о...
Как правильно сделать авторизацию двух разных групп пользователей. 3
9 часов назад
С ним славу богу все хорошо. Он пошел дальше по карьерной лестнице, оставил MODX позади и сейчас заглядывает к нам только поздороваться.
Не могу справиться с fullCalendar"ем 7
Вчера в 10:53
Как раз при редактировании с фронта добавить проверку не проблема, но надо код компонента смотреть
Доступ только к определенным страницам 4
Вчера в 07:41
Если используете ispmanager, отключите параметр open_basedir
Передан пустой файл (Minishop2 - галерея) 7
Вчера в 07:35
страниц много, но как вариант возможно.
В целом конечно пока не совсем понятно как лучше настроить контроль версий, я вот пока все сунул в Docker ...
Что удаляется в папке core/cache после того как нажали кнопку "Очистить кэш" в админке? 7
11 ноября 2024, 11:29
Этот компонент для связки с любым фреймворком?
К примеру с astro.build/ этим можно связать?
gtsAPI - Универсальное API для MODX 2
11 ноября 2024, 09:46
Добрый день! Вы можете у сниппета ecMessage в параметре threads указать *. Про это есть в документации.
easyComm - комментарии, отзывы, вопросы на сайте 536
08 ноября 2024, 23:04
попробуйте убрать autoplay здесь:
allow="clipboard-write; autoplay"
Вставка видео с Rutube с управлением на сайте 4
08 ноября 2024, 16:24
Для select вот так сделал. Может пригодится тоже.
<select>
<option data-sort="" data-dir="" class="sorty sort&q...
Сортировка "По умолчанию" в mFilter2 2
Всего 123 779 комментариев
Если не хотите писать простой output filter, который по id выберет name статуса — пропишите текстом статус в теле письма.
1. MODX_CORE_PATH. 'components/packagename/processors/'
2. Проверьте, $this->modx->packagename->config — возможно там есть конфиг вашего пакета, если он верно вызван в контроллере.
Но тут выбор был не за мной.
Всем советую, это не сложно и недорого, а в итоге сэкономит нервы и время(деньги).
Во-первых, через какое-то время после того как отключил session_handler_class пошли ошибки и в админке, и на самом сайте. Исправил добавлением в .htaccess строки
php_value session.auto_start on
Потом, когда появилось время разбираться дальше, то первым делом вернул все назад — подключил session_handler_class и убрал auto_start сессии. Но скрипт корзины продолжил срабатывать каждый раз.
И до сих пор первоначальная проблема не повторилась, хотя все вернулось на исходные. Надеюсь и не повториться. :)
В общем почему пропал этот глюк я понять не смог. Мистика. %)
Сделал поле description и сортировку баннеров в позиции, перетаскиванием.
Благодарность будете присылать?
Запускать все сайты от одного юзера, или ставить 777 — одинаково небезопасно.
В любом случае это обозначает, что получив доступ к одному сайту, злоумышленник может накуралесить и на остальных.
Правильнее система: один сайт — один юзер, причем не www-data и не root. И права 755, 644. И отдельный доступ для этих юзеров через sftp, для работы с файлами.
просто через ssh
для директорий
find /path/to/dir -type d -exec chmod 755 {} \;
для файлов
find /path/to/dir -type f -exec chmod 644 {} \;
если хотите в файлах поменять к примеру только файлы с расширением php, то добавляем -iname
пример — меняем все php файлы
find /path/to/dir -type f -iname "*.php" -exec chmod 644 {} \;
Подскажите, пожалуйста, как лучше (безопаснее) поступить в моей ситуации, сменить владельца или выставить 777?
Есть хорошая новость — скоро буду вносить в него изменения, появится поле description и еще может что-то.
$modx->addPackage('rehab', $modx->getOption('core_path').'components/rehab/model/','modx_rehab_');
$modx->addPackage('rehab', $modx->getOption('core_path').'components/rehab/model/','modx_rehab_');
$access = $modx->getObject('Access',1);
print $access->get('uid');